How much do Tesla interns make?

How much does a Intern at Tesla make? The typical Tesla Intern salary is $32 per hour. Intern salaries at Tesla can range from $11 – $60 per hour.

Does Tesla give interns housing?

Does Tesla help with relocation or housing? We provide relocation stipends for interns located 50 miles or more from their work site. We also offer housing for select interns at Gigafactory Nevada.

Do NASA interns get paid?

NASA Interns receive stipends based on their education level to help defray internship-related expenses. Most NASA Interns are undergraduate or graduate students. Some centers may offer opportunities for high school students (16 years of age or older) and current professional educators.

How many hours do interns work?

During the school year interns usually commit between 10 and 20 hours a week. In the summer interns may commit up to 40 hours a week, especially if the internship is paid.

    What jobs did Nikola Tesla have?

    Nikola Tesla was a Serbian-American engineer and inventor who is highly regarded in energy history for his development of alternating current (AC) electrical systems. He also made extraordinary contributions in the fields of electromagnetism and wireless radio communications.

    What is an internship program?

    An internship is an official program offered by an employer to potential employees. Interns work either part time or full time at a company for a certain period of time. Internships are most popular with undergraduates or graduate students who work between one to four months and have a goal to gain practical work or research related experience.
